Spanish

Etymology

From Latin impotēns.

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): /impoˈtente/ [ĩm.poˈt̪ẽn̪.t̪e]

Adjective

impotente m or f (masculine and feminine plural impotentes)

  1. (medicine) impotent
  2. impotent, powerless, helpless
